Still, we only felt it polite to warn you that the latest trailer for Mortal Kombat X (that's ten, not an ugly misuse of the letter x) is really, quite impossibly violent.
From circular saw hats to bladed fans, every surface on display is either razor sharp or covered in pints of blood. The combat animations look so fluid you'll find your thumbs mapping out combos memorised in the mists of your youth.
And don't skip out early - keep watching the trailer to the end to see which classic character makes a return for the tenth title.
Mortal Kombat X arrives on PlayStation 4, Xbox One, PlayStation 3, Xbox 360, PCs on 14 April
